Horticultural Therapy with Amy Petersen
Healing Spices for Fall/Winter
Wiarton Arena & Community Centre, Auditorium 7-8:30PM
December 18 2023
Join us for this 1.5-hour long workshop where you will be invited to connect with nature in meaningful ways through the 5 senses. This class will offer a unique experience that will bring you closer to the natural environment and support your social, emotional, mental and physical health and wellbeing.
In this program we will investigate the health qualities of 9 spices for fall and winter. Through the sense of smell we will discover the grounding, calming, revitalizing, invigorating and cleansing qualities as well as other healing properties. We will prepare stewed apples to eat or take home.
More about your instructor:
Amy is a Registered Horticultural Therapist with the Canadian Horticultural Therapy Association and loves to see people find their own unique connection with nature. Amy spent 7 years working with the elderly in Long Term Care with the Region of Peel and now is sharing her passions with the community in South Bruce Peninsula. Her love of plants and love of people are perfectly combined in her work as a Horticultural Therapist.
